About Brackenthwaite

Brackenthwaite rests in Cumbria's rolling embrace, a quiet corner of England where the land itself seems to hold its breath. It lies 8.2 km south-south-east of Brampton (from Brampton: bearing 167°T, OS grid NY 547 530), and is situated south-south-east of Castle Carrock village.
